Profile
Full stack Asp.Net C# web developer with +4 years of experience in various career environment. Outgoing, straightforward, detailed oriented and enthusiastic by every new challenge. Proficient at analysis and delivering business needs into fascinating user experience web apps by maneuvering and steering front and back end web development. Always updating knowledge by latest technologies.
Duties and Responsibilities:
1-Design, program, code and update web applications as full stack developer with back-end development with C# ASP.Net MVC 5 to front-end development with HTML5,CSS,SASS,JavaScript and jQuery.
2- Deep knowledge for browser compatibility and cross browser development.
3-Improving user experience with latest updated trends on web for usability.
4-Fixing usability issues and applying testing with users.
5-Analyze, collect and diagram business models with UML and Entity Relationship Diagrams.
6-Following software development methodologies like SCRUM and Kanban for planning and delivering user and business requirements.
7-Applying Security principles for web applications using ASP.Net Identity framework.
8-Applying WebApi and RESTful web services.
10-Improving web applications request speed and performance by using techniques such as HTML minifying, CSS and JS bundling and HTTP handlers for caching and compression.
11-SQL server development plus integrating back-end programming with data using Entity Framework.
-Software development using Windows forms and UI's.